The Mg-Sm phase diagram has been experimentally studied by x-ray diffraction, scanning electron microscope equipped with energy dispersive spectrometer, and differential scanning calorimetry. Five binary compounds, Mg41Sm5, Mg5Sm, Mg3Sm, Mg2Sm and MgSm were confirmed to exist in the Mg-Sm system. In addition to Mg2Sm and MgSm, Mg3Sm was found to be a congruently melting phase. The Mg5Sm and Mg2Sm were found to be only stable at high temperatures and decompose above 400 °C in this work. A special effort was made to determine the extent of the solid solubility ranges of Mg3Sm, Mg2Sm, MgSm and, γ-Sm. The Mg-Sm binary system was modeled using the Calphad approach based on new experimental data of this work and all reliable experimental information from literature. A complete thermodynamic description of the Mg-Sm system is obtained and extensive comparisons between calculated and experimental data are presented, indicating that almost all available experimental and theoretical data are fitted satisfactorily.
